On 3/7/23 14:47, Cédric Le Goater wrote:
On 32-bit hosts, RAM has a 2047 MB limit. Use a macro to define the
default ram size of machines (AST2600 SoC) that can have 2 GB.

Signed-off-by: Cédric Le Goater <c...@kaod.org>
---
  hw/arm/aspeed.c | 21 +++++++++------------
  1 file changed, 9 insertions(+), 12 deletions(-)

diff --git a/hw/arm/aspeed.c b/hw/arm/aspeed.c
index 6880998484cd..9fca644d920e 100644
--- a/hw/arm/aspeed.c
+++ b/hw/arm/aspeed.c
@@ -47,6 +47,13 @@ struct AspeedMachineState {
      char *spi_model;
  };
+/* On 32-bit hosts, lower RAM to 1G because of the 2047 MB limit */
+#if HOST_LONG_BITS == 32
+#define ASPEED_RAM_SIZE(sz) MIN((sz), 1 * GiB)
+#else
+#define ASPEED_RAM_SIZE(sz) (sz)
+#endif
+
